Summary
The 10th Conference of the International Association of Manichaean Studies (IAMS) deals with all aspects of Manichaeism and especially the Manichaean reception of biblical texts. The conference takes place at Aarhus University 9–12 August 2021 with international keynote speakers. Manichaeism was religion which from its beginning in Mesopotamia in the third century AD spread to East and West, reaching Europe and China, and existed for more than a millennium. Today, Manichaean manuscripts have been discovered in Egypt and Central Asia, and Manichaean studies thus unite scholars working in numerous different fields, e.g., Art History, Historical studies in Christianity and other religions, and Philology in a great number of ancient languages from Europe, Africa and Asia.
